测试环境搭建与恢复策略
需积分: 13 83 浏览量
更新于2024-08-23
收藏 854KB PPT 举报
"本资源主要关注测试环境的搭建、恢复及管理,旨在确保测试环境的一致性和稳定性。"
测试环境的恢复是软件测试过程中至关重要的环节,它涉及到测试环境的一致性维护和测试数据的保护。当测试环境遭受破坏时,能够快速恢复到之前的状态,确保测试工作的连续性和准确性。恢复过程通常依赖于定期备份的系统,通过这些备份,我们可以还原测试环境,使其回到先前的稳定状态,从而满足测试需求。
测试环境由硬件环境、网络环境和软件环境三部分组成。硬件环境包括必要的服务器、客户端设备、网络连接设备以及辅助硬件。为了节约资源,可以设置基础硬件配置来满足测试的基本需求。软件环境则涵盖了操作系统、数据库和其他应用软件,这些软件需与被测软件兼容,避免共存软件引发的冲突或影响。网络环境则涉及网络设备、网络结构和网络系统,保证被测软件在网络环境下的正常运行。
测试环境的构建应尽可能接近实际生产环境,以确保测试结果的可靠性。同时,环境应符合软件运行的最低硬件和软件要求,选择广泛使用的操作系统和软件平台,保持环境的纯净和独立,并确保无病毒存在。不同的测试阶段(如单元测试、集成测试、系统测试和验收测试)对测试环境的需求各异,参与人员从开发者到测试者,再到最终用户,环境复杂度逐渐增加。
测试环境的备份与恢复是确保测试连续性的关键步骤。备份应定期执行,以便在环境损坏时能迅速恢复。恢复策略可能包括完整恢复、增量恢复或差异恢复,具体取决于备份策略和环境的具体情况。此外,测试数据的获取也是测试环境管理的一部分,可能需要模拟真实数据或使用匿名化的真实数据,以确保测试的全面性和真实性。
通过学习本课程,学员将掌握测试环境的组成,了解如何根据项目需求搭建测试环境,熟练进行环境备份和恢复操作,以及有效地获取和管理测试数据。这将有助于提高整个测试流程的效率和质量,减少因环境问题导致的测试错误和延误。
2009-02-24 上传
2022-06-12 上传
2008-04-12 上传
2010-06-01 上传
2022-11-01 上传
点击了解资源详情
2008-11-26 上传
2010-10-08 上传
2008-10-27 上传
李禾子呀
- 粉丝: 24
- 资源: 2万+
最新资源
- 新代数控API接口实现CNC数据采集技术解析
- Java版Window任务管理器的设计与实现
- 响应式网页模板及前端源码合集:HTML、CSS、JS与H5
- 可爱贪吃蛇动画特效的Canvas实现教程
- 微信小程序婚礼邀请函教程
- SOCR UCLA WebGis修改:整合世界银行数据
- BUPT计网课程设计:实现具有中继转发功能的DNS服务器
- C# Winform记事本工具开发教程与功能介绍
- 移动端自适应H5网页模板与前端源码包
- Logadm日志管理工具:创建与删除日志条目的详细指南
- 双日记微信小程序开源项目-百度地图集成
- ThreeJS天空盒素材集锦 35+ 优质效果
- 百度地图Java源码深度解析:GoogleDapper中文翻译与应用
- Linux系统调查工具:BashScripts脚本集合
- Kubernetes v1.20 完整二进制安装指南与脚本
- 百度地图开发java源码-KSYMediaPlayerKit_Android库更新与使用说明